Method for controlling regeneration of diesel particulate filter in exhaust gas passage of combustion engine of vehicle, involves regulating heating capacity of filter such that flow and temperature conditions are monitored by filter

The method involves introducing combustion of particles to a particulate filter (42) during regeneration process by controlling local energy. The local energy is input based on input parameters. Heating capacity of the particulate filter is regulated such that flow and temperature conditions are controlled, determined and monitored by the particulate filter. A filter model of the particle filter is utilized to determine and store material data of the particulate filter from current input conditions. The particulate filter is divided into various portions. An independent claim is also included for a device for controlling regeneration of a particulate filter in an exhaust gas passage of a combustion engine.
